      Lip trainers for oral posture are becoming more discussed in Fairfield as part of myofunctional wellness tools. These small resistance devices are designed to strengthen the lips and surrounding facial muscles while encouraging proper tongue and lip posture. The goal is to support nasal breathing habits, reduce habitual mouth breathing, and improve overall oral muscle coordination. Users typically incorporate lip trainers into short daily exercises, often alongside breathing drills. While some report improved awareness of facial posture and reduced dryness in the mouth, scientific evidence is still limited. Experts suggest using them as a supplementary tool, not a replacement for medical or orthodontic care.
